Scenario 1: Mutual vs. Unilateral Obligation You're meeting with a potential client about a web design project. They send an NDA that reads: "Company shall not disclose Freelancer's business methods, pricing structure, or client list to third parties for 3 years after the project ends." The NDA is one-way only, it protects your secrets but imposes no obligations on them. What's your position? A) Sign immediately, this is a standard freelancer NDA

B) Reject and request a mutual NDA where both parties have equal obligations C) Sign but add language requiring them to use reasonable security measures D) Request to remove the 3-year term and replace it with 1 year Answer: B Red Flag Risk: A one-way NDA signals the other party believes their information is more valuable than yours. You're giving protection you don't receive.
